EKSPERIMENTASI MODEL PROBLEM BASED LEARNING DAN MODEL PEMBELAJARAN MISSOURI MATHEMATICS PROJECT DITINJAU DARI SIKAP SISWA TERHADAP MATEMATIKA PADA MATERI PERSAMAAN DAN PERTIDAKSAMAAN LINEAR SATU VARIABEL KELAS VII SMP NEGERI SE-KABUPATEN BELITUNG Firna Irnistisia; Tri Atmojo Kusmayadi; Riyadi Riyadi
Journal of Mathematics and Mathematics Education Vol 6, No 1 (2016): Journal of Mathematics and Mathematics Education (JMME)

Abstract

Abstract: The objective of this research was to investigate the effect of the  learning models on the learning achievement in mathematics viewed from students attitude toward mathematics. The learning models compared were the problem based learning (PBL) type, the cooperative learning model of the missouri mathematics  project (MMP) type, and the direct learning model. This research used the quasi experimental research. Its population was all of the students in Grade VII of State Junior Secondary Schools of Belitung regency in Academic Year 2014/2015. The samples of the research were taken by using the stratified cluster random sampling technique and consisted of 285 students. They were grouped into three classes, namely: 95 students in Experimental Class 1, 96 students in Experimental Class 2, and 94 students in Control Class. The instruments to gather the data were test of achievement in learning mathematics and the students attitude toward mathematics questionnaire. The proposed hypotheses of the research were analyzed by using the two way analysis of  variance with unbalanced cells. The results of the research were as follows. 1) The cooperative learning model of the PBL type results in a better learning achievement in Mathematics than the cooperative learning model of the MMP type  and  the  direct  learning  model,  the cooperative  learning  model of  the  MMP type results in a better learning achievement in Mathematics than the direct learning model. 2)  The  students  with  the high attitudes toward mathematics have a better learning achievement in mathematics than those with the moderate students attitudes toward mathematics and  those with  the low students attitudes toward mathematics, the students with the moderate attitudes toward mathematics have a better learning achievement in mathematics than those with the low students attitudes toward mathematics. 3) There was an interaction the aforementioned learning models and the categories students attitude toward mathematics on the learning achievement in mathematics of the students.Keywords: PBL, MMP, and students attitude toward mathematics.
EKSPERIMENTASI MODEL PEMBELAJARAN KOOPERATIF TIPE TEAM ASSISTED INDIVIDUALIZATION (TAI) DAN TEAMS GAMES TOURNAMENT (TGT) PADA MATERI PERSAMAAN DAN PERTIDAKSAMAAN DITINJAU DARI GAYA BELAJAR SISWA KELAS X SMK SE-KABUPATEN NGAWI TAHUN PELAJARAN 2015/2016 Lia Septy Nirawati; Tri Atmojo Kusmayadi; Imam Sujadi
Journal of Mathematics and Mathematics Education Vol 7, No 1 (2017): Journal of Mathematics and Mathematics Education (JMME)

Abstract

Abstract: The purpose of this study was to know the effect of the learning models on the learning achievement in mathematics viewed from the students adversity quotient. The learning models compared were the cooperative learning of TAI, TGT, and direct learning model. The type of research was a  quasi-experimental research with a  3x3 factorial design. The study population was all grade 10 students of Secondary Schools in Ngawi Regency in the academic year of 2015/2016. Instruments used for data collection were mathematics achievement test and learning style questionnaire. The data analysis technique used was the two-way ANOVA with unequal cell. Based on the hypothesis test, it was concluded that: 1) The mathematics learning achievement of the students who were treated by TAI learning model was better than the mathematics learning achievement of the students who were treated by TGT and direct learning model on equality and inequality, the mathematics learning achievement of the students who were treated by TGT learning model was better than the mathematics learning achievement of the students who were treated by direct learning model on equality an inequality; 2) The mathematics learning achievement of the students with visual type was better than the mathematics learning achievement of the students with auditory or kinesthetic type and the learning achievement of auditory type students was better than  the  learning  achievement of kinesthetic type students on equality and inequality; 3) The visual type students who were treated by TAI learning model had better mathematics learning achievement than the students with TGT or direct learning model and the students mathematics learning learning  achievement with TGT learning model was same the students with direct learning model; the mathematics achievement of auditory type students who were treated by TAI learning model had better mathematics learning achievement than the students with TGT or direct learning model and students who were treated by TGT learning model had better mathematics learning achievement than the students with direct learning model; the mathematics achievement of kinesthetic type students who were treated by TAI, TGT, and direct learning models had the same mathematics learning achievement; 4) In TAI, TGT and direct learning model, the mathematics learning achievement of visual type, auditory, and kinesthetic had the same mathematics learning achievement.Keywords: TAI, TGT, Direct Learning Model, Learning Style, Mathematics Learning Achievement
